Input Prices
The costs associated with purchasing the raw materials, labor, and other factors of production required to produce goods or services.
Industry Expands
The process of growth within a specific sector of the economy, characterized by an increase in output, sales, or the number of operators.
Average Total Cost Curve
A graphical representation showing the average total cost of producing different quantities of output.
Purely Competitive Firm
A company that operates in a market where there are many buyers and sellers, the products are homogeneous, and there are no barriers to entering or exiting the market.
